Germany Offshore Decommissioning Market Overview


As per MRFR analysis, the Germany Offshore Decommissioning Market Size was estimated at 353.43 (USD Million) in 2023. The Germany Offshore Decommissioning Market Industry is expected to grow from 366 (USD Million) in 2024 to 731 (USD Million) by 2035. The Germany Offshore Decommissioning Market CAGR (growth rate) is expected to be around 6.491% during the forecast period (2025 - 2035).

Germany Offshore Decommissioning Market Drivers


Increasing Regulatory Pressure for Environmental Protection


Germany has positioned itself as a leader in environmental regulations, stemming from its commitment to sustainability. The German government has implemented stringent laws mandating decommissioning processes that minimize ecological impact. For example, the Offshore Installation Regulation requires detailed assessments and plans for decommissioning to ensure compliance with the latest environmental standards. According to the Federal Ministry for Economic Affairs and Energy, these regulations ensure that decommissioning activities must adhere to the EU's stringent environmental performance targets.

This regulatory framework not only instigates the need for efficient decommissioning services but also encourages industry players to adopt innovative methodologies in the Germany Offshore Decommissioning Market Industry. Established organizations like Deutsche TV and DNV GL have significantly influenced this metric by promoting best practices in technology and compliance, fostering a safe and sustainable decommissioning process while pushing the industry toward growth.


Aging Offshore Infrastructure in the North Sea


The North Sea has a significant concentration of aging offshore assets that are due for decommissioning. Reports indicate that nearly 30% of offshore oil and gas installations in the North Sea are over 30 years old and require comprehensive decommissioning strategies. According to the German government's energy report, the projected lifecycle of many offshore platforms is nearing completion, indicating an urgent need for sustainable decommissioning services.Companies like Wintershall Dea and Equinor are actively involved in planning and executing decommissioning projects in these waters, creating substantial opportunities in the Germany Offshore Decommissioning Market Industry. The growing number of aging installations, combined with the push for environmental responsibility, forecasts a robust growth trajectory for this market.

Offshore Decommissioning Market Type Insights


The Germany Offshore Decommissioning Market presents a diverse framework segmented by Type, which plays a crucial role in the overall industry landscape. The Types within this market include Top Side, Substructure, Sub Infrastructure, and others, reflecting the varying structures and components involved in the decommissioning process. Germany, with its extensive offshore energy production, demands a comprehensive approach to decommissioning. The top Side encompasses above-water structures like platforms and equipment, which require careful dismantling and removal due to their complex configurations. This segment is vital for ensuring environmental safety and compliance with local regulations during decommissioning operations. Substructure refers to the underwater bases that support offshore installations, mainly consisting of steel and concrete.

It is essential to address this segment adequately, as these structures can impact marine ecosystems if not dismantled properly. The Sub Infrastructure Type includes pipelines, cables, and other buried systems that are fundamental to offshore projects. Their decommissioning involves specialized techniques to prevent pollution and uphold sustainability commitments. Offshore Decommissioning Market Service Type Insights


The Germany Offshore Decommissioning Market, particularly focusing on the Service Type segment, plays a crucial role in ensuring the safe and efficient dismantling of outdated offshore structures. This market comprises various important activities such as Well Plugging and Abandonment, Conductor Removal, and Platform Removal. Well Plugging and Abandonment are significant as it involves sealing wells to prevent leaks and environmental hazards, aligning with Germany's stringent environmental regulations. Conductor Removal is crucial for the proper elimination of structural elements that can pose risks after the cessation of production.

Furthermore, Platform Removal signifies the complete dismantling of offshore installations, a process critical for restoring marine environments. Offshore Decommissioning Market Application Insights


The Germany Offshore Decommissioning Market is witnessing a growing focus on its Application segment, with significant emphasis on environmental sustainability and regulatory compliance leading the way. Within this segment, the industry is broadly categorized into Shallow Water and Deep Water applications, both playing crucial roles in the decommissioning process. Shallow Water decommissioning is typically less complex and less costly, allowing for quicker turnaround times and fulfilling Germany's strict environmental standards. On the other hand, Deep Water operations present unique challenges including harsher environmental conditions and complex infrastructure, making advanced technology and expertise critical for success.
